Heat Resistance Aramid Staple Fiber good thermal stability
Heat resistance aramid fiber: Intermediate aramid fiber has good thermal stability, can be used continuously under the condition of 205℃, and can still maintain high strength under the high temperature condition of more than 205℃. The intermediate aramid fiber has a higher decomposition temperature, and will not melt and melt drop under high temperature conditions, when the temperature is greater than 370℃ began to carbonize. 2D 51MM Flame Retardant Aramid Staple Fiber High Strength
Flame Retardant aramid fiber: The flame retardant properties of intermediate arylon are determined by its own chemical structure, so it is a permanent flame retardant fiber, not due to the use of time and washing times to reduce or lose flame retardant properties. Intermediate aramid fiber has good thermal stability, can be used continuously under the condition of 205℃, and can still maintain high strength under the high temperature condition of more than 205℃.
